引言
在当今数字化时代,拥有一个个人网站或博客变得愈发重要。GitHub作为一个强大的版本控制和代码托管平台,不仅可以用于存储代码,也提供了GitHub Pages功能,可以轻松搭建和托管网站。本文将详细介绍如何使用GitHub搭建网站,从创建账户到发布网站,一步一步带您深入了解。
第一步:创建GitHub账户
要使用GitHub,首先需要拥有一个GitHub账户。
- 访问 GitHub官网。
- 点击右上角的“Sign up”按钮。
- 填写注册信息,包括用户名、邮箱和密码。
- 验证邮箱,完成账户的创建。
第二步:创建一个新的仓库
账户创建完成后,接下来需要创建一个新的仓库。
- 登录到您的GitHub账户。
- 点击右上角的“+”按钮,选择“New repository”。
- 输入仓库名称(通常使用“username.github.io”的格式,其中“username”是您的GitHub用户名)。
- 选择“Public”作为仓库的可见性。
- 点击“Create repository”按钮完成创建。
第三步:准备网站文件
在开始之前,您需要准备好网站文件。这些文件通常包括:
- HTML文件(如index.html)
- CSS样式文件(如style.css)
- JavaScript文件(如script.js)
- 图片文件(如logo.png)
您可以使用文本编辑器(如VS Code或Sublime Text)创建这些文件。
第四步:上传文件到GitHub仓库
创建仓库后,您需要将准备好的网站文件上传到GitHub。
- 在您刚刚创建的仓库页面,点击“Upload files”。
- 将准备好的文件拖拽到上传区域,或点击“choose your files”选择文件。
- 填写提交信息,建议简洁描述所做的更改。
- 点击“Commit changes”完成上传。
第五步:启用GitHub Pages
上传文件后,需要启用GitHub Pages功能,使网站可以被访问。
- 在仓库页面,点击“Settings”选项卡。
- 向下滚动到“GitHub Pages”部分。
- 在“Source”下拉菜单中选择“main branch”。
- 点击“Save”按钮。
- GitHub会为您提供一个网址,通常为“https://username.github.io”,这就是您网站的地址。
第六步:自定义域名(可选)
如果您希望使用自己的域名,可以按照以下步骤进行配置:
- 在您购买域名的注册商处,将DNS设置为CNAME记录,指向“username.github.io”。
- 在GitHub仓库的“Settings”中,找到“Custom domain”输入框,输入您的域名并保存。
- 创建一个CNAME文件,内容为您的自定义域名,并上传到仓库根目录。
常见问题解答
如何确保我的网站在手机上也能良好显示?
您可以使用响应式设计,通过CSS媒体查询来确保网站在不同设备上显示良好。
如何修改我网站的主题?
您可以通过更改CSS文件或使用现成的主题模板来修改网站的外观。
GitHub Pages支持哪些编程语言?
GitHub Pages主要支持静态网站文件,如HTML、CSS和JavaScript。动态内容可以通过API实现。
网站上线后,如何更新内容?
只需对您的文件进行修改,上传更改后的文件并提交。GitHub会自动更新您的网站。
GitHub Pages是免费的还是收费的?
GitHub Pages提供免费托管服务,但自定义域名的注册和DNS管理通常需要付费。
结论
使用GitHub搭建网站是一种简单、快速且免费的方式。无论您是技术小白还是有一定经验的开发者,按照上述步骤都可以顺利搭建自己的个人网站。希望本文能帮助您成功实现自己的在线梦想!
正文完